Energy Minister Franklin Khan is expected to be appointed alternative chairman of the Gas Exporting Companies Forum (GECF) executive board at the 19th ministerial meeting of the GECF in Moscow, Russia. The meeting takes place from October 3 to 7.

This means that Khan, who will lead the TT delegation to the F meeting, will miss the presentation of the 2017/2018 budget in Parliament on October 2 He will also miss Opposition Leader Kamla Persad-Bissessar's response to the budget on October 6.

In a statement yesterday, the Energy Ministry said Khan's appointment means that TT will host the annual ministerial meeting in 2018.

The GECF is considered the gas equivalent of the Organisation of Oil Exporting Countries (OPEC), with its member countries accounting for approximately 67 per cent of the world natural gas reserves.

The Fourth GECF Gas Summit is scheduled to take place in Santa Cruz, Bolivia on November 24. This is a biennial meeting of heads of state and government of GECF member countries. Current members of the GECF include Algeria, Bolivia, Egypt, Equatorial Guinea, Iran, Libya, Nigeria, Qatar, Russia, TT, United Arab Emirates and Venezuela.

Azerbaijan, Iraq, Kazakhstan, Netherlands, Norway, Oman and Peru are observers.
